The latest independent OECD/Nebraska Tests confirm what
New Holland TG Series tractor owners already know: a TG
tractor is the best in its class when it comes to lugging
ability, pulling power, hydraulic flow and fuel efficiency.
The University of Nebraska Tractor Testing Laboratory
conducted the tests on the TG tractors according to Organization
of Economic Cooperation and Development (OECD) standards.
The test results show that the TG Series tractors are
best in class in a number of key areas that affect productivity
and efficiency.

The Nebraska Tests show that when it comes to lugging ability
and pulling power, the TG leads the industry. The TG has the
highest maximum torque rise of any tractor in its class
up to 64.3%. This exceptional torque rise gives TG tractors
the power to pull right through the toughest spots.
TG tractors are built strong with a standard 3-point lift capacity
of up to 16,375 pounds. The High Lift Option increases that
number to 17,931 pounds. And TG tractors have lots of raw pulling
power. The Nebraska Tests rated the maximum ballasted drawbar
pull at up to 30,650 pounds.
TG tractors have one of the highest hydraulic delivery rates
on the market at up to 39 gallons per minute and thats
before adding New Hollands exclusive optional MegaFlow
hydraulic system. With MegaFlow, hydraulic flow can be boosted
to 70.2 gpm to run air seeders, potato harvesters and other
specialty equipment more efficiently.
Tests performed on TG tractors show fuel efficiency of up to
18.07 hp-hrs per gallon. Unlike miles per gallon, horsepower-hours
per gallon measures the amount of work accomplished with each
gallon of fuel. The higher the number, the better the fuel efficiency.
In addition, New Holland tractors also offer an exclusive productivity-enhancing
feature, the optional tight-turning SuperSteer FWD front
axle option. No other tractor can match the 16.5-feet turning
radius of a TG tractor on 30-inch rows.
